Simon P. Hughes Jr.
Summary
Simon P. Hughes Jr. is a human[1]. Simon P. Hughes Jr. was born in Smith County[2]. Simon P. Hughes Jr. was born on April 14, 1830[3]. Simon P. Hughes Jr. died in Little Rock[4]. Simon P. Hughes Jr. died on June 29, 1906[5]. Simon P. Hughes Jr. worked as a politician[6], lawyer[7], and judge[8]. Simon P.
